Peter Weilbacher wrote: > Most of the canvas examples that I could find display correctly now. The > only thing that doesn't is the Firefox TabPreview extension (and the > corresponding SeaMonkey patch). There, the canvas that is drawn of the > page appears upside down. It seems that most (all?) parts of the code > that relay height to y-axis value in the canvas code are checked with > topToBottom and OS/2 gives that correctly. Any hints of where to look > for an explanation?
Let me ask differently: Does any code of the canvas implementation rely on system coordinates to start at the top left (while under OS/2 the origin in the _bottom_ left)? I looked through the code again a bit, but maybe I was too tired. If nobody here can answer this where should I post instead? (There is no canvas newsgroup.) -- Thanks!
